Tony Christopher was 6-for-9 with five runs scored, three RBIs and three stolen bases on Saturday versus Kenyon. Denison will play for the NCAC Championship on May 8-9 in Granville.

After capturing NCAC West title, the Big Red baseball squad will move on to the NCAC Championship series next weekend after downing the Lords of Kenyon College, 15-3 and 6-5.

Game one turned out to be "Senior Day Part Two" as right-handed starter James Clear (Hamilton, Ohio/Badin) went the distance, allowing one earned run and striking out six in nine complete innings. Fellow senior Tony Christopher (Moreland Hills, Ohio/Chagrin Falls) came up two feet short of hitting for the cycle as his pair of triples and trio of RBIs led the offensive barrage from the Big Red.

Innings of four, three and seven runs, combined with five Kenyon errors, allowed the Big Red to run through six different hurlers out of the bullpen to close the game.

The hot bats slowed to open game two. Sophomore first baseman Park Smith (Warren, N.J./Pingry) singled through the left side to score freshman Danny Pritz (Wilmette, Ill./Lyons Twp.) to put the Big Red on the board. Junior Andy Johnson (Cincinnati, Ohio/Sycamore) added another on his RBI single to score freshman third baseman Kevin Teague (Fairfax Station, Va./St. Stephen's and St. Agnes) to give the Big Red a 2-0 advantage.

After Smith again drove in Pritz in the top of the fifth to push the lead to three. But in the bottom of the fifth, the Lord bats woke up, tying the game at three after loading the bases with one out. In the sixth, a 2 RBI double to right center by designated hitter Pat Gunn put Kenyon on top.

Fast forward to the top of eight, game tied at three, as Christopher opened the inning with a single up the middle. Freshman speedster Len Mills (Pittsburgh, Pa./Upper St. Clair) pinch ran for Christopher and was driven in by sophomore cather Alex Horn (Centerville, Ohio/Centerville) with a single through the left side of the infield.

Pritz singled in the leadoff spot to score Johnson as he slid under the tag to knot the game at five. After a pitching change, senior left fielder Tim LaBolt (LaGrange, Ill./Lyons Twp.) followed that up by driving in Horn to take the lead that would hold.

Sophomore Aidan Lucas (Evanstown, Ill./Evanston Twp.) came in for the two-inning save for his seventh of the season. With the save, the flamethrower moved into second all-time for saves in a single season trailing Matt Streicher with eight.

Pritz and senior Tim LaBolt (LaGrange, Ill./Lyons Twp.) combined to go 6-10 in the one and two spots of the lineup for the game and 13-23 on the day.

Denison awaits word on their match-up for next weekend. The winner of the Wooster-Ohio Wesleyan series will travel to Granville for the best two out of three game championship series Thursday and Friday.
